达梦数据库Linux创建
时间: 2025-06-22 09:41:31 浏览: 9
### 安装和配置达梦数据库
#### 创建用户与用户组
为了确保安全性和权限管理,在Linux环境中安装达梦数据库之前,应当先创建专门用于运行该软件的服务账户及其对应的用户组。具体命令如下:
```bash
groupadd dinstall
useradd -s /bin/bash dmdba
passwd dmdba
```
上述指令分别完成了新建名为`dinstall`的用户组、向其中加入新成员`dmdba`并为其设定初始登录口令的操作[^3]。
#### 设置资源限制
考虑到大型应用可能消耗较多系统资源的情况,建议适当调整内核参数来提高性能表现。特别是对于文件描述符数量这一项尤为重要,可以通过编辑/etc/security/limits.conf文件实现永久生效更改;或者直接修改当前会话中的ulimit值作为临时解决方案。
#### 准备安装包及解压路径
选择合适的存储位置放置即将使用的介质,并赋予恰当访问控制属性给目标文件夹以便后续顺利展开工作流程。
```bash
mkdir -p /dm8/
chown -R dmdba:dinstall /dm8/
chmod -R 764 /dm8/
```
此部分操作旨在建立一个专供本次任务使用的临时空间 `/dm8/`, 同时指定了其拥有者身份为先前定义好的 `dmdba` 用户以及关联的 `dinstall` 组别, 并给予必要的读写许可权能.
#### 执行实际安装过程
切换至提前规划好用来承载发行版压缩包的位置 (`cd /mnt/dm`) ,接着启动图形界面引导工具完成整个部署环节:
```bash
sudo su - dmdba
cd /mnt/dm
./DMInstall.bin
```
按照屏幕上的指示一步步推进直至结束,期间可能会涉及到接受协议条款、指定组件选项等内容交互活动[^2].
#### 配置环境变量
为了让shell能够识别到新增加的应用程序可执行文件所在之处,需追加相应记录进入个人profile文档里头去。
```bash
echo 'export DM_HOME=/opt/dmdbms' >> ~/.bash_profile
echo 'export PATH=$PATH:$DM_HOME/bin' >> ~/.bash_profile
source ~/.bash_profile
```
这段脚本的作用在于告知操作系统有关于达梦数据库的具体安放地点(`DM_HOME`) 和 将其 bin 子目录添加入全局搜索路径(PATH),最后通过重新加载配置使改动即时生效[^1].
#### 初始化实例和服务注册
当一切准备工作就绪之后就可以着手构建首个逻辑单元——即所谓的 "实例" 。这一步骤通常由特定命令行实用程序负责处理,它不仅会自动生成所需的各种配置档案还会自动将自身登记成为开机自启项目之一。
```bash
dmserver $DM_HOME/install/data/DAMENG.DBF
```
这条语句里的 `$DM_HOME` 是前面已经声明过的环境变量代表了产品根目录地址; 而后面跟的部分则是指向模板SQL脚本的实际物理路径.
阅读全文
相关推荐

















